  • Product Description

    MG 526 Roll Pin for Magnum manual pallet jack frames. Manufactured from high-carbon spring steel for retention of frame and linkage components in Magnum Intrupa 5000 series pallet jacks. Meets ANSI/ASME B18.8.2 spring pin specifications.

    Compatibility: Fits pallet jacks made by Magnum, model 5000. SKU: MG 526

    Frequently Asked Questions

    Q: What is the MG 526 and what does it do?
    A: The MG 526 is a roll pin designed for Magnum manual pallet jack frames. It functions as a retention and connecting pin for frame and linkage components on Magnum Intrupa model 5000 series pallet jacks.

    Q: What material is the MG 526 roll pin made from?
    A: The MG 526 is manufactured from high-carbon spring steel, meeting ANSI/ASME B18.8.2 specifications. The material is SAE 1060 or equivalent with a minimum Rockwell hardness of C45, providing strong retention under load.

    Q: Which Magnum pallet jack models use the MG 526 roll pin?
    A: The MG 526 is compatible with Magnum Intrupa model 5000 series manual pallet jacks. Verify your equipment model and serial range before ordering to confirm fitment.

    Q: How often should the MG 526 roll pin be inspected or replaced?
    A: Inspect the MG 526 roll pin regularly during routine equipment maintenance. High-carbon spring steel provides durability, but replace the pin if you observe rust, deformation, or loss of tension in frame and linkage assemblies.
